A "spiritual guide," spits alcohol into a worshiper's mouth to perform a spiritual cleansing during the celebrations of Maximon in San Andres Itzapa, Guatemala, on October 28. Unlike other traditional benevolent saints in Latin America, Maximon, who at times looks more like a bandit than a saint, can grant both good and evil requests.

A street monkey wears a baby doll mask as it performs in a slum in Jakarta, Indonesia. Security forces are fanning out across Jakarta conducting raids to rescue macaques used in popular street masked monkey performances in a move aimed at improving public order and preventing diseases carried by the monkeys.

A soldier escorts men as they arrive from the rebel held suburb of Moadamiyeh to the government held territory in Damascus, Syria. Nearly 2,000 residents of the besieged western Damascus suburb of Moadamiyeh have fled their homes and have surrendered to the Syrian authorities after reports of starvation and disease triggered an international outcry for their help.
Saw Min lies on a bed with weights on her eyes after receiving local anesthesia ahead of a cataract operation at a government hospital in Bago, Myanmar. She waited with hundreds of Myanmar's poorest villagers to be prepped for the simple, free surgery she hopes will restore her sight.
